福宁湾底栖生物群落生态研究 被引量:3

Studies on ecology of benthic community in Funing Bay

摘要 2012年对围海造地后的福宁湾特殊生境海区开展春季、夏季两季的生态调查,研究底栖生物群落生态现状。两航次调查共鉴定底栖动物57种,其中软体动物24种,多毛类19种,甲壳动物9种等。总栖息密度407.5个/m2,其中软体动物占有65.6%的明显优势;总生物量为338.44g/m2,其中软体动物占有98%的绝对优势。种类数、生物密度和生物量三项指标,均为春季显著高于夏季,堤内高于堤外;聚类分析表明,季节是影响群落时空变化的主要因子;堤内外群落的差异主要与沉积物类型密切相关。 Six stations were established to investigate the benthos in funing bay Land reclamation in spring and summer of 2012. 57 species of benthos are indentifided in the two cruises, among which there were 24 species of Mollusca, 19 species of Polychaeta, 9 species of Crustacea. The total benthis density is 407.5 ind/m2 and most of them are the Mollusca (65.6%). The total benthis biomass is 338.44 g/m2 and most of them are the Mollusca (98%). Species number, biomass and density in spring were significantly higher than in summer, and increased from the open sea to inside estuary. Results of Cluster indicate that seasonal succession answer for tht fluctuation in the communities of benthos, while the types of sediment answer for the differences between the the open sea and inside estuary.
